*** Death The clock keeps ticking Life keeps fleeting A state of urgency Things we can't get to

It's like watching a burning candle go down So brief, the lights Blown away by the winds Here now, gone then What's next, you wonder

Then comes the need to solidify Rifts to close Chaos to mend Rivals to settle Before it stops our heart

How far can we go To bridge a grudge and bring love back How much can we prepare To leave a legacy and go in peace Death, it keeps calling us.
